Why GLP-1 Medications Are Prescribed GLP-1 receptor agonists such as semaglutide (Wegovy) and liraglutide are approved for: Adults with a body mass index (BMI) of 30 or greater Adults with a BMI of 27 or greater with at least one weight-related condition such as hypertension, type 2 diabetes, or high cholesterol These medications mimic the GLP-1 hormone, which helps regulate appetite, glucose levels, and insulin secretion
